Lower selling prices on the sawn softwood markets and a minor reduction in the volume of sawnwood sold by the "Wood" division of Svenska Cellulosa Aktiebolaget (SCA) of Stockholm, Sweden, in the first quarter of 2020 led to a reduction in the key performance figures.
